中文摘要:
      结合2008年和2014年的调查数据,对海南岛南部海草分布现状进行分析探讨。结果显示,海南岛南部海草种类有2科3亚科5属5种,即海神草 Cymodocea rotunda、泰莱藻 Thalassia hemprichii、海菖蒲 Enhalus acoroides、喜盐草 Halophila ovalis 以及二药藻 Enhalus acoroides,泰莱藻广泛分布;海草分布面积从2008年的1.64 km2减少到2014年0.50 km2,减少幅度较大区域为铁炉港和小东海;平均盖度从2008年35.67%下降到2014年26.40%;受人为活动及无人管理因素影响程度不同,海南岛南部不同海域海草平均密度及平均生物量各有不同,后海湾与鹿回头海草平均密度和平均生物量呈增长趋势,铁炉港、西瑁洲岛及小东海海草平均密度和平均生物量呈下降趋势。鉴于海南岛南部海草资源已出现退化,希望社会各界重视海草的保护,在海草资源丰富区域设海草保护区,在海草破坏严重区域加大政府科研扶持力度,对海草进行保护与修复。
英文摘要:
      Analysis and discussion of the distribution status of the seagrass in the southern part of Hainan island, based on the investigation data that were collected in 2008 and 2014. The results show that, the species of the seagrass in the southern part of Hainan island have 2 families, 3 subfamily, 5 genera and 5 species, namely Cymodocea rotunda, Thalassia hemprichii, Enhalus acoroides, Halophila ovalis, Enhalus acoroides, and the Thalassia hemprichii was distributed widely. Tielugang lagoon and Xiaodonghai were the decreased greatly areas, when the distribution of the seagrass has decreased by 1.64 km2 to 0.50 km2, and the average coverage of seagrass was downed by 35.67% to 26.40% from 2008 to 2014. It was difference to the average density and average biomass when they was subjected to the different influencing factors of the human activity and no one manage. The average density and biomass have increased in Huohai Bay and Luhuitou, while them have decreased in the areas just as Tielugang lagoon, Ximaozhou Island and Xiaodonghai. It hopes all society sectors to protection of seagrass, set up seagrass reserves in the rich seagrass resources areas, increase the government scientific support to protection and restoration of seagrass in the destroyed severity areas, in view of the seagrass resources has showed a degradation phenomena.
